My Buying Guides on Rain X Graphene Spray Wax
What I Look for Before Buying
When I shop for Rain X Graphene Spray Wax, I first think about what I want most: shine, water beading, easy application, or longer-lasting protection. I like products that save me time, so a spray wax that goes on quickly and wipes off cleanly is important to me. I also check whether it works well on paint, glass, plastic trim, and wheels, since I prefer one product that can do more than one job.
Why I Consider Graphene Spray Wax
I’m drawn to graphene spray wax because it usually promises a slick finish, strong water repellency, and better durability than basic spray waxes. For me, that means my car stays cleaner longer and is easier to wash next time. I also like the idea of getting a deep gloss without needing a full detailing session.
Ease of Use Matters to Me
One of the biggest reasons I would choose Rain X Graphene Spray Wax is convenience. I want a product that sprays evenly, spreads easily, and buffs off without leaving streaks. If I have to work too hard to remove residue, I usually lose interest fast. A good spray wax should feel simple enough for regular use.
Surface Compatibility I Check
Before I buy, I make sure the product is safe for my car’s surfaces. I look for clear instructions on whether it can be used on clear coat, paint, chrome, glass, and trim. I also pay attention to whether it’s safe on hot surfaces or in direct sunlight, because I don’t always have perfect weather when I’m detailing.
Finish and Appearance I Expect
I want my car to look glossy, smooth, and well cared for after using spray wax. With Rain X Graphene Spray Wax, I would expect a slick finish and visible water beading. If a product gives my paint a richer look and helps reduce dust sticking, that’s a big plus for me.
Durability and Protection
For me, a spray wax is only worth it if it offers more than a temporary shine. I look for something that can hold up through a few washes and light weather exposure. If Rain X Graphene Spray Wax gives me decent protection against rain, UV, and road grime, I see that as good value.
Value for Money
I always compare the price with how much product I get and how often I’ll need to reapply it. A slightly higher price can still be worth it if the finish lasts longer and the bottle goes a long way. I like buying products that make my car look better without forcing me to spend too much on detailing supplies.
